Kristina Brennan
Adoptions Specialist, Coeur d'Alene
I am a mother to four children, and married into a family that has been touched by adoption. This experience showed me the rewards that are inherent in adopting children, and allowed me to witness the life-long journey that adoption presents. I have traveled to Guatemala to be a part of reuniting my brother-in-law and my sister-in-law with their birth mother. I support the Eagle’s Nest orphanage in Solala, Guatemala with my time and resources. My passion is educating and preparing families for their adoption journey. In 2005, I was presented with the “Mary Johnson Adoption” award from the Idaho Department of Health and Welfare for helping to achieve timely permanency for Idaho’s children and for service to adoptive families in Idaho.
Experience and education:
- Experience in foster care and adoptions since 1999
- Licensed Social Worker (LSW) and Certified Adoption Professional
- Received Bachelor’s in Social Work (BSW) from Lewis-Clark State College
